The 1967 Wake Forest Demon Deacons football team was an American football team that represented Wake Forest University during the 1967 college football season. In their fourth season under head coach Bill Tate, the Demon Deacons compiled a 4–6 record and finished in fifth place in the Atlantic Coast Conference.[2]
